Peer reviewedLee, Gary R.; Whitbeck, Les B. – Rural Sociology, 1987
Uses path analysis and data from 2,829 Washington State residents aged 55 and over to study effects of rural or urban residence on social integration/loneliness. Finds rural residents not more highly integrated into social networks than urban counterparts and not lonelier. Discusses implications for existing social relations stereotypes of the…

Peer reviewedPascarella, Ernest T.; And Others – Research in Higher Education, 1986
A longitudinal study of factors influencing the long-term academic persistence of 825 students beginning their postsecondary education in two-year colleges supports the importance of person-environment fit in persistence. Measures of academic and social integration most consistently correlated positively with persistence, while student precollege…
